In Example 10.1 we considered conditions for whichvigorous boiling occurs in a pan of water, and wedetermined the electric power (heat rate) required tomaintain a prescribed temperature for the bottom ofthe pan. However, the electric power is, in fact, thecontrol (independent) variable, from which the tem-perature of the pan follows.(a) For nucleate boiling in the copper pan of Exam-ple 10.1, compute and plot the temperature ofthe pan as a function of the heat rate for 1?q?100 kW.(b) If the water is initially at room temperature, itmust, of course, be heated for a period of timebefore it will boil. Consider conditions shortlyafter heating is initiated and the water is at 20?C.Estimate the temperature of the pan bottom for aheat rate of 8 kW
